Why Consider This Job Opportunity
The Distribution Key Accounts Manager is responsible for maximizing Murata's sales and market share on assigned distribution accounts. This position takes ownership of the distributor relationship and collaborates with all stakeholders using Murata's long-standing Voice-of-Customer philosophy as a guideline. The Distribution Key Accounts Manager will be the primary contact for corporate interactions between Murata and assigned distributor accounts.
Workplace Policy
Hybrid from Carrollton, TX; Atlanta, GA; or Schaumburg, IL.
What To Expect (Essential Job Responsibilities)
- Conducts virtual and in-person meetings at distributor locations to review performance, improvement areas, establish strategic direction, and opportunities to promote Murata's products and solutions.
- Leads distributor meetings and conference calls, publishes minutes, and drives action items to closure.
- Stays updated on distributor business conditions and direction.
- Reviews and sets goals on key Performance Indicators (KPI's) including Point of Sale, Point of Purchase, and inventory levels.
- Leads the internal communications of relevant information with key Murata stakeholders.
- Develops influence with the key decision-makers at all levels of distributors' corporate and regional organizations including Sales, Product Management, Marketing, Quality, Logistics, and Senior Management.
- Reviews, maintains, and assures effective implementation and execution of distributor contracts and programs including Supplier Scorecard.
- Accurate forecasting by analyzing market and customer trends as well as customerinsights.
- Inventory analysis and recommendation in support of Murata product positioning.
- Responsible for proactively answering customer inquiries and resolving their concerns.
- Communicate new product introductions and stocking packages. Positions new products and technologies with distributor.
